Gavin Newsom's potential presidential campaign will spotlight California’s conditions during his two terms, particularly issues like homelessness and high living costs. While he promotes state achievements, critics emphasize persistent problems such as expensive housing. High living costs contributed to Kamala Harris's loss in the last election, making Newsom vulnerable to similar criticisms in 2028. He has implemented legislation to boost housing production and mitigate electricity costs, which disproportionately affect low-income residents, particularly during extreme heat. These economic challenges are likely to be central to his campaign narrative.
